(Gast)
n/a Beiträge
|
Re: SchredderProg (mit source) gesucht!
3. Jul 2004, 18:47
Ich kann es wiederherstellen!
PS:
Wenn ichs so mache wird dann 12 mal überschrieben?
Delphi-Quellcode:
procedure TForm1.SpeedButton1Click(Sender: TObject);
const Buffer = 1024;
var
arr: array [1..Buffer] of byte;
fi: file;
i, n: integer;
begin
if OpenDialog1.Execute then
begin
AssignFile(fi, OpenDialog1.FileName);
Reset(fi, 1);
n := FileSize(fi);
FillChar(arr, SizeOf(arr), #0);
FillChar(arr, SizeOf(arr), $00);
FillChar(arr, SizeOf(arr), $FF);
FillChar(arr, SizeOf(arr), $00);
FillChar(arr, SizeOf(arr), $F0);
FillChar(arr, SizeOf(arr), $0F);
FillChar(arr, SizeOf(arr), $00);
FillChar(arr, SizeOf(arr), $00);
FillChar(arr, SizeOf(arr), $FF);
FillChar(arr, SizeOf(arr), $00);
FillChar(arr, SizeOf(arr), $F0);
FillChar(arr, SizeOf(arr), $0F);
FillChar(arr, SizeOf(arr), $00);
for i := 1 to n div Buffer do
begin
BlockWrite(fi, arr, n mod Buffer);
end;
CloseFile(fi);
Erase(fi);
end;
end;
Ich kann diesen Dateinamen vernichtung nicht eintragen, bin ja newbie , kann mir jemand helfen?
|
|
Zitat
|